Unit 1 Review – Date: __________________________ Directions: Complete this mixed practice packet to help you prepare for the Unit 1 Exam. Skills 1) Determine whether a relation is a function. 2) State the domain and range of a relation. 3) Evaluate functions. 4) Graph a function using a table of values.* 5) Given two points, calculate slope of a line.* 6) Classify slope as positive, negative, zero, or undefined. 7) Isolate a variable.* 8) Graph a line.* 9) Identify the x- and y- intercept of a line.* 10) Complete application problems involving all skills marked with an *.
